Blekinge Institute of Technology (BTH)

Blekinge Institute of Technology (BTH) is a recognised university in Sweden. Below is what AlmiStudy records about it — only verified fields are shown; anything not confirmed is deliberately left out rather than guessed.

CityKarlskrona
RegionEurope
TypePublic
SubjectsSoftware Engineering; Computer Science; Electrical Engineering; Mechanical Engineering; Industrial Economics; Health (Nursing); Spatial Planning
AccreditationSwedish Higher Education Authority (UKÄ — Universitetskanslersämbetet); Swedish Council for Higher Education (UHR); European Higher Education Area (EHEA / Bologna Process since 1999)
Official websitehttps://www.bth.se/eng/
Accreditation registryhttps://english.uka.se/
Blekinge Institute of Technology (1989) is a smaller technical university (~7,000 students) with a strong applied software-engineering and IT profile.
